Competition History
The CART series competition at the Rodriguez Brothers Autodrome in Mexico City was first held in 1980 and lasted two years on the calendar of the series.
Two decades later, the race returned to the championship calendar, becoming a traditional stage in the final part of the season. The competition in Mexico lasted on the calendar of the series until its last full season.
Stages of different years
The most winning pilot in the history of the prize is the Frenchman Sebastien Burde , who won three times in Mexico City . Two victories on the account of the American Rick Mirza .
Five of the eight races submitted to the riders who became champions of the series that year. The three pilots who won the race and did not win the title were Rick Mirz , Kenny Braque and Justin Wilson .
The best achievement of Mexican pilots in the home race is the third place won by Mario Dominguez in 2003.
